What is a typical workday like for a remote content developer?

A typical workday for a Remote Content Developer often involves researching assigned topics, creating and editing content, and publishing it through digital platforms or content management systems. Collaboration is usually conducted virtually, utilizing project management tools and regular video meetings to align with team goals or gather feedback. In addition to writing, you may be responsible for optimizing content for SEO, incorporating multimedia elements, and ensuring brand consistency across all deliverables. This role offers flexibility in work hours but also requires strong self-motivation and time management to meet deadlines. The remote nature allows you to collaborate with diverse teams and work independently from virtually anywhere.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ote content developer?

To thrive as a Remote Content Developer, you need strong writing, editing, and research skills, often supported by a relevant degree in communications, journalism, or a related field. Familiarity with content management systems (CMS) like WordPress, SEO tools, and sometimes basic graphic design or HTML are commonly required. Excellent time management, collaboration, and communication abilities are vital for working independently and with distributed teams. These competencies ensure content is engaging, accurate, and optimized for digital platforms while meeting project deadlines and goals.

What is a remote content developer?

A Remote Content Developer creates, edits, and manages digital content for websites, blogs, social media, e-learning platforms, or marketing campaigns while working from a remote location. They research topics, write engaging content, optimize for SEO, and collaborate with designers and marketers. Strong writing, editing, and digital communication skills are essential. This role often requires self-discipline, time management, and familiarity with content management systems (CMS).

Job Summary
Voyager Technologies is seeking a Senior Electrical Power Systems Engineer to help shape the future of lunar technologies and missions. Advanced Programs leads the company's earliest stage work, from mission concept definition and long-term technology road mapping to hands on development of breakthrough technologies that will power our next generation of lunar landers, surface systems, and spacecraft. In this role, you will define end-to-end mission concepts for NASA, government, and commercial customers, directly influencing the technologies and architectures that will drive Astrobotic's future lunar pursuits.
This position is based out of Pittsburgh, PA and can be either onsite or remote.
Job responsibilities:
  • Develop and review new concepts and designs of lunar landers, rovers, surface power systems, and spacecraft.
  • Support the development and technical content creation for B&P, R&D, or mission opportunities.
  • Develop the system-level technical vision for new products - connecting customer needs with feasible, high-performing solutions across hardware and software domains.
  • Develop and perform trade studies to support technical, business, and/or programmatic actions and decision-making.
  • Perform power and avionics design and analysis for all mission concepts, right-sizing the power architecture to meet end-to-end mission objectives and requirements.
  • Contribute to programmatic topics such as schedules, resourcing, and budgets estimations.
  • Communicate with other engineering disciplines, partners, customers, and vendors to resolve technical risks and challenges.
  • Occasionally participate in visits and technical interchange meetings with customer and partner organizations.
  • Translate abstract customer requirements into actionable product goals and system architectures that can be presented to customers, utilized in proposals, and marketed to stakeholders.
  • Participate in cross functional team meetings to ensure engineering solutions comply with mission and business needs and company technology roadmap.

Required Qualifications
  • B.S. in Aerospace Engineering, Systems Engineering or similar related discipline plus 10 years of relevant engineering experience. Relevant advanced degree will be considered in lieu of equivalent experience.
  • Demonstrated experience in one or more of the following areas: space system development, systems engineering, structure/thermal design and analysis, avionics, power systems, propulsion, orbital mechanics, electrical systems, mechanical & fluid systems, software & controls, modeling & simulation, and/or manufacturing.
  • Experience developing technical content for proposals and external customer presentations.
  • Experience authoring and decomposing mission and system-level requirements.
  • Strong understanding of the launch, space, and lunar environments.
